Output eba891d933bf71762efdb84863df36606f655236149a1babb95cc3f033ddec35:9

value
415322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14f9992125de4723402135a85c4b2ee40bf996a OP_EQUAL
address
3HrYtCFHAXFhTorzM2F1MY3dgxoN8Nkuwp
transaction
eba891d933bf71762efdb84863df36606f655236149a1babb95cc3f033ddec35
confirmations
175185
spent
true